Partisan polarization has long been a fact of political life in the United States. And it seems like politics is everywhere these days — at the dinner table, in the classroom and on every screen.

That raises some big questions for parents. How do we talk to our kids about what’s going on without passing along fear or cynicism? How do we raise thoughtful, respectful people amid divisive rhetoric?

MPR News guest host Catharine Richert and her guests explore how parents can talk with their kids about politics without anger, divisive rhetoric and polarization.
